Transaction 627062a7326d863f54bd4b16e7671fcee38415a123a3a3dfff54339de1eb4e26
1 Input
1 Output
-
627062a7326d863f54bd4b16e7671fcee38415a123a3a3dfff54339de1eb4e26:0
- value
- 280514
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d509bd5b38c020dc6638fb3893b7764940b5ba9
- address
- bc1qr4gfh4dn3spqm3nr37ecjwmhvj2qkkaf9dt658